Michael Olatunde Fadayomi, a 40-year-old Nigerian football coach in London has been stabbed to death in front of teenage son.
Fadayomi, better known as Tunde was killed on Thursday in a fight that broke out between his son and someone in a bus at North West London.
His son who has not been named, according to local media, was heading to football training when he ran into trouble and called his father to intervene.
Reports said the fight spilled out onto the pavement.
Tunde was reportedly stabbed several times by his killer.
Police have since arrested a 42-year-old man on suspicion of murder.
